BY A STAFF REPORTER: Uttar Pradesh's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ath on Friday visited Ram Temple to review preparations for the Pran-Pratishtha ceremony which is scheduled on 22nd January in Ayodhya, Uttar Pradesh. 

Yogi was accompanied by Black Cat Commandos of the National Security Guard (NSG) and members of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Teerth Kshetra Trust. This is his second inspection visit after 12th January. Moreover, he visited the Temple on the 4th day of Ram Mandir's consecration process. 

The consecration process is on its 4th day. The parisar pravesh ceremony (placement of Lord Ram on the sanctum sanctorum) concluded on Thursday, 18th January. Moreover, the Ram Temple consecration rituals began on January 16 Tuesday, and will continue for seven days. The final ritual will be performed by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on 22nd January. Over 7,000 dignitaries will attend the grand Pran-Pratishtha ceremony on 22nd January in Ayodhya, Uttar Pradesh.
